Climate

1991–2020 normalsElizabethSavannah
Annual avg temperature56°F68°F
January avg low26°F40°F
July avg high87°F92°F
Annual snowfall31.5"0.0"
Annual precipitation46.6"48.1"

Climate warms by 12.0°F on the annual average — 55.5°F → 67.5°F.

Snowfall is a non-factor at the destination: Savannah sees under an inch a year per NOAA normals.

Source: NOAA U.S. Climate Normals 1991–2020 (stations: NEWARK INTL AP, NJ US, SAVANNAH INTL AP, GA US).

Best time to move

Moving companies typically charge 20–30% more between Memorial Day and Labor Day (peak season). October through April offers the lowest rates and better mover availability.

To avoid mid-semester school transfers, most U.S. families schedule moves between mid-June and mid-August. Public school calendars typically run late August or early September through late May or early June.
